About this role

Whitecap Resources Inc. is a leading Canadian energy company committed to delivering reliable returns to shareholders through the responsible development of oil and natural gas assets in the Western Canadian Sedimentary Basin. With a strong track record of profitable growth and a sustainable dividend, Whitecap delivers long-term value to investors, supported by investment-grade financial strength.

Since September 2009, Whitecap has experienced remarkable growth, increasing production from 850 boe/d to over 365,000 boe/d. We have unconventional and conventional assets exclusively focused in Western Canada and the asset base includes the Weyburn EOR Project. As a majority owner and operator of the Weyburn EOR Project, annually we safely sequester approximately 1.5 million tonnes of CO2 making it a unique project within our portfolio. We currently employ 1,200 people, including our valued contract staff.

Position Overview:

Working within the Asset Integrity Team, the Asset Integrity Inspector is responsible for performing a wide range of integrity management activities as prescribed in Whitecap’s Pressure Equipment Integrity Management System manual. The successful candidate will work with Engineering, Operations, and Maintenance teams throughout the entire life cycle of Whitecap’s equipment including design, installation, commissioning, operations, inspection, repair and eventual decommissioning. The Asset Integrity Inspector will be responsible for the integrity management of all boilers, pressure vessels, pressure relief devices, storage tanks and on-lease and above ground piping within the Kaybob Operating area.

The successful candidate will be required to travel to field and office locations within Alberta, as required. It is preferred that the successful candidate live within a reasonable distance from Fox Creek or Whitecourt, AB.

Responsibilities:

  • Perform internal, external and installation inspections.

  • Coordinate non-destructive testing and visual inspection activities completed by third parties.

  • Complete integrity assessments on pressure equipment and assign inspection intervals.

  • Develop equipment  repair plans and aid in the coordination of repair activities including direct supervision and certification of repair activities.

  • Develop and update inspection scopes of work and coordinate vendors to execute the inspections.

  • Evaluate and assess PSV service reports.

  • Support the implementation of our PEIMS program.

  • Participate in Field & Asset Integrity team meetings.

  • Report incidents and failures to regulatory bodies and the corporate Chief Inspector.

  • Support internal conformance reviews, regulatory audits, failure analyses and risk assessments.

  • Work with provincial regulators to ensure corporate and regulatory compliance.

  • Responsible for maintaining accurate asset inventories and operating status within corporate and regulatory databases.

  • Provide technical inspection assistance to engineering and construction teams.

  • Inspect and recommend protective coating systems and repairs.

  • Remain up to date and knowledgeable on all applicable codes, standards, and regulations.

  • Field coordination and cost control for integrity monitoring and assessment activities.

  • Provide Asset Integrity support in other Whitecap Operating areas as needed.

Qualifications:

  • Minimum of 5 years of experience within the oil & gas industry in a similar role with 5 years of experience completing in-field inspections.

  • API 510, preference given to 570 and 653 Inspector Certifications.

  • ABSA ISI-BPVPP or ISI-PVPP Certification

  • Working knowledge of applicable industry codes such as CSA B51, ASME SEC I, IV, VIII, IX, B31.3, B31.1 and API Inspection Codes

  • Working knowledge of welding procedures, processes and NDE techniques.

  • Standard oil and gas safety tickets
